Speed compared to traditional payments
Speed is usually the first thing users notice.
With crypto:
- Deposits often reflect quickly
- Withdrawals can be processed faster in many cases
- There is less waiting compared to some traditional methods
But it is not always consistent.
Network activity can affect how fast transactions move.
So while it feels faster overall, it is not always predictable.

Value fluctuation impact
One thing that stands out with crypto is value change. The value of the currency can go up or down. This affects how users see their balance. Sometimes it works in their favor. Sometimes it does not. And that adds a small layer of uncertainty.
